Job responsibilities
- Accountable for completing the project safely, on time and within budget
- Accountable for stakeholder satisfaction and managing their expectations throughout the project
- Accountable for effective collaboration and communication with and between all stakeholders
- Accountable for project cost control and financial performance
- Manages the project from contract award through to project closure
- Accountable for variation, scope management and claims
- Accountable for creating the project plan and executing it
- Responsible for obtaining stakeholder approvals where required
- Controls material and inventory; carries out claim analysis
- Performs subcontractor qualification, evaluation and selection
- Negotiates subcontractor scope, terms and rates; raises purchase orders and certifies invoices
- Takes care of all administrative activities of the project including project reports
Specific Project Management
- Responsible for the Project Start-Up meeting, ensuring clear handover from the CSE / Solution team
- Coordinates with the CSE Project Engineer throughout the project on technical changes, variation orders and addworks
- Responsible for the project safety plan, quality plan, labour plan and logistics plan
- Responsible for site methodology and execution specific to existing building environments
- Triggers the invoice and collection process on time
- Responsible for monthly project reviews, project audits, handovers and final closure
- Ensures smooth handover of completed project works to the maintenance team
